(10E)-17-benzyl-3,6,13-trihydroxy-6,8,15-trimethyl-14-methylidene-4-oxa-18-azatetracyclo[10.7.0.01,16.03,5]nonadec-10-ene-7,19-dione

Also Known As: Engleromycin, (11)Cytochalasa-6(12),13-diene-1,17-dione, 19,20-epoxy-7,18,21-trihydroxy-16,18-dimethyl-10-phenyl-, (7S,13E,16S,18R,21S)-, 2H-Oxireno(9,10)cycloundec(1,2-d)isoindole-3,13(4H,14H)-dione,1a,5,5a,6,7,8,8a,11,12,14a-decahydro-2,8,14-trihydroxy-6,12,14-trimethyl-7-methylene-5-(phenylmethyl)-, (2S,2aR,5S,5aR,6S,8S,8aR,9E,12S,14R)-

CAS: 77784-06-6
Molecular Formula C28H35NO6
Molecular Weight 481.25 g/mol
LogP 1.9067
Topological Polar Surface Area 119.39 Ų
Hydrogen Bond Donors 4
Hydrogen Bond Acceptors 6
Rotatable Bonds 2
Exact Mass 481.24643
Heavy Atoms 35
Complexity 1082.1782

Chemical Identifiers

CAS Number 77784-06-6
SMILES CC1C/C=C/C2C(C(=C)C(C3C2(CC4(C(O4)C(C1=O)(C)O)O)C(=O)NC3CC5=CC=CC=C5)C)O

Property Insights of Engleromycin

The XLogP value of 1.9067 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Engleromycin. The TPSA of 119.39 Ų falls within the moderate polarity range, balancing permeability and solubility for Engleromycin. Following Lipinski's Rule of Five, Engleromycin has 4 hydrogen bond donor(s) and 6 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
